Transaction 88fffc18540711ebf449ddac4f36c00ea42b3e1803dad65675861915d2b55d72
2 Input
2 Outputs
- 88fffc18540711ebf449ddac4f36c00ea42b3e1803dad65675861915d2b55d72:0
- 88fffc18540711ebf449ddac4f36c00ea42b3e1803dad65675861915d2b55d72:1
value 101562500
address 2NFccAbzq8RhHMx2h27meUPjc229zbNzMuz
value 95989358615
address mzwFG7Pp6AaHNFtCcZqpmG8n9YszC8Ggxm